Sydney, New South Wales vs Irbid Climate & Distance Between

Jordan flag
  • The distance between Sydney, New South Wales, Australia and Irbid, Jordan is approximately 14,104 km or 8,764 mi.
  • To reach Sydney, New South Wales in this distance one would set out from Irbid bearing 110.4° or ESE and follow the great circles arc to approach Sydney, New South Wales bearing 107.9° or ESE .
  • Sydney, New South Wales has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Irbid has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a).
  • Sydney, New South Wales is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Irbid is in or near the subtropical thorn woodland bi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 0.7 °C (1.2°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 6.5 °C (11.7°F) less in Sydney, New South Wales.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 827.1 mm (32.6 in) more which is equivalent to 827.1 l/m² (20.3 US gal/ft²) or 8,271,000 l/ha (884,225 US gal/ac) more. About 2 3/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 2° lower in Sydney, New South Wales than in Irbid.
